Cooper Kupp and wife Anna lock lips on sideline during Seahawks WR's return to LA for Rams game

Seattle Seahawks wide receiver Cooper Kupp returned to Los Angeles for the first time since his departure from the Rams. The Seahawks were defeated by the Rams 21-19 and Kupp had just three catches for 23 yards on the day.

Anna Kupp shared her pride for her husband and his effort in a post on Instagram on Sunday evening. Along with her heartfelt words as she also shared a photo of a special pregame moment on between them on the sidelines at SoFi Stadium.

"So proud to be yours. To be held by you, to be loved by you," Anna wrote.

This nine games this season he has 29 catches for 390 receiving yards and just one touchdown this season.

Kupp was drafted by the Los Angeles Rams in the third round of the 2017 NFL Draft after playing college football at Eastern Washington.

He played eight seasons with the Rams until the team decided to part ways with him during the offseason. He helped the Rams win Super Bowl LVI and was named Super Bowl MVP. He signed with the Seattle Seahawks in March on a three-year deal worth $45 million.

Cooper Kupps' wife Anna shared gameday recap after big win over Cardinals

The Seattle Seahawks had a dominant win in the NFC West matchup against the Arizona Cardinals in Week 10. Anna Kupp shared a recap of the gameday with a carousel of photos on Instagram.

She shared a photo of her on the sidelines with the wide receiver as well as in the stadium suite with their son. Anna Kupp and the other wives and significant others of Seahawks players also posed for a photo on the sidelines.

"Midas kind of love, everything is gold. Found the blessing in the curse, now the treasure is ours to hold. ✨💙" Anna shared.

En route to the 44-22 win over the Cardinals, Cooper Kupp had two catches for 74 yards.
